Best Sandwich Restaurants in Kenilworth, England
Home
United Kingdom
England
Kenilworth
Sandwich Restaurants
Subway
Abbey End, Kenilworth, CV8 1QJ, United Kingdom
Website
Greggs
19 Warwick Road, Kenilworth, CV8 1HN, United Kingdom
Website
Login
Email
Password
Remember me
Forgot password?
Login
Don't you have an account?
Register Here